My Mom's Chocolate Chip Cookies

Recipe #380140 | 20 min | 10 min prep | add private note

By: Mrs*Schlopy
Jul 3, 2009

Very yummy ooey gooey cookies

SERVES 24 -36 , 24 Cookies (change servings and units)

Ingredients

Directions

  1. 1
    Preheat oven to 350°F.
  2. 2
    Cream together the butter, white sugar, and brown sugar until smooth.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la. Dissolve the baking soda in hot water. Add to the batter along with the salt. Stir in the flour, chocolate chips. Drop by spoonfuls or a melon baller onto an ungreased cookie sheet.
  3. 3
    Bake for about 10 minute or until the edges are nicely browned. I only bake for roughly 8 minutes -- High altitude -- and we like them a little gooeier.
